308: How to Make Creative Ideas Irresistible with Allen Gannett
Episode description
Software founder and CEO Allen Gannett shares the critical components of successful ideas–and how to create more of them.
You’ll Learn:
1) The two fundamental human desires that come together in winning innovations
2) Little things to tweak to make your offering a smashing success
3) The four laws of the creative curve
About Allen
Allen Gannett is the founder and CEO of TrackMaven, a marketing analytics platform whose clients have included Microsoft, Marriott, Saks Fifth Avenue, Home Depot, Aetna, Honda, and GE. He has been on the “30 Under 30” lists for both Inc. and Forbes. He is a contributor for FastCompany.com and author of The Creative Curve, on how anyone can achieve moments of creative genius, from Currency, a division of Penguin Random House.
